About CFTRI and its R&D Departments


Central Food Technological Research Institute is a premier Research Institution under the Council of Scientific & Industrial Research (C.S.I.R), New Delhi and is engaged in research and development in the field of Food Science and Food Technology.  R&D Departments of CFTRI include Biochemistry & Nutrition, Fermentation Technology & Bioengineering, Flour Milling, Baking & Confectionary Technology, Food Engineering, Food Microbiology, Food Packaging Technology, Food Protectants & Infestation Control, Food Safety & Analytical Quality Control Laboratory, Fruits & Vegetable Technology, Grain Science & Technology, Lipid Science & Traditional Foods, Meat Fish & Poultry Technology, Plant Cell Biotechnology, Plantation Products, Spices & Flavour Technology, Protein Chemistry & Technology, Sensory Science, Human Resource Development and other related basic areas with well qualified and experienced Scientists, Engineers and Technologists.  The efforts of these R&D Departments are complimented by support Departments and Resource Centres spread over the Country.  An advanced Central Instrumentation Facility with all the modern instruments required for Biological Sciences and a Pilot Plant equipped with state-of-the-art equipments and an excellent Library are also part of the infrastructure.
